7.18 Apache TomcatにおけるFusekiのデプロイ

Apache TomcatにFusekiをデプロイするには、Tomcatの管理Webページを使用するか、Fusekiの.warファイルをTomcatのwebappsフォルダにコピーして自動的にデプロイします。

このトピックでは自動デプロイ・ステップについて説明します。$FUSEKI_BASEの設定が完了し、構成ファイルが存在する(デフォルトでは、Fusekiの構成ファイルを格納するディレクトリとして/etc/fusekiが使用されます)。

  1. 最新バージョンのApache Tomcatをダウンロードしてインストールします。

    これらの手順では、Apache Tomcatインストール・ディレクトリのルートを、$CATALINA_HOMEと呼びます。

  2. fuseki.warをTomcatのwebappsフォルダにコピーします。たとえば、次のようにします。

    cd $CATALINA_HOME/webapps
    cp /tmp/jena_adapter/fuseki_web_app/fuseki.war  .
    
  3. Tomcatを起動します。

    $CATALINA_HOME/bin/startup.sh
    

    このファイルに実行権限がない場合は、次のコマンドを入力してから再度Tomcatを起動します。

    chmod u+x $CATALINA_HOME/bin/startup.sh
    
  4. ブラウザで、http://hostname:8080/fusekiに移動します。